This is a "heat soak" problem - my car has stock exhust system (except for catbacks)/stock starter and I have the same problem when it's real hot outside and I sit in traffic. Stop open the hood for 10-15 minutes and it starts back up. Had the same problem in my 67 Camaro too. Shielding the starter from the headers effectively is all you can do. I put ceramic header wrap on the Camaro and pretty much stopped it. Ceramic coated headers would go a long way in reducing the problem if you don't have aftermarkets on there already.
